Mastering the 6 Step: The Foundation of Breakdancing Footwork

The 6 Step is a cornerstone of breaking footwork, consisting of a six-count circular pattern that dancers use to move across the floor. This foundational move requires coordination, balance, and rhythm, making it essential for beginners to master. With its origins in the early days of hip-hop, the 6 Step continues to be a crucial element in the breaking vocabulary, serving as a building block for more complex footwork combinations and freestyle expressions.

Mastering the 4 Step: A Fundamental Breaking Move

The 4 Step is a foundational breaking move that involves a rhythmic sequence of leg movements performed in a squatting position. This essential footwork pattern teaches new breakers balance, coordination, and rhythm while serving as a versatile base for more advanced techniques. Mastering the 4 Step is a crucial milestone for any aspiring b-boy or b-girl looking to build their breaking skills.

Mastering the 3 Step: A Fundamental Breaking Move for Aspiring B-Boys and B-Girls

The 3 Step is a fundamental breaking move consisting of three distinct steps that form the basis of many footwork patterns. This versatile move involves alternating between a crunch position and stepping out to the side while switching hands and feet. Mastering the 3 Step is essential for aspiring b-boys and b-girls, as it improves floor work, coordination, and serves as a building block for more complex breaking routines.
